Section 21.2823 - Applicability to Certain Noncontracting Physicians and Providers

Universal Citation: 28 TX Admin Code § 21.2823

Current through Reg. 50, No. 13; March 28, 2025

The provisions of § 19.1719 of this title (relating to Verification for Health Maintenance Organizations and Preferred Provider Benefit Plans) and § 21.2807 of this title (relating to Effect of Filing a Clean Claim) apply to a physician or a provider that provides to an enrollee or an insured of an MCC:

(1) care related to an emergency or its attendant episode of care as required by state or federal law; or

(2) specialty or other medical care or health care services at the request of the MCC, the physician, or the provider because the services are not reasonably available from a physician or a provider who is included in the MCC's network.
